Efficient work order processing is the backbone of streamlined maintenance and field service operations, directly enhancing productivity and reducing downtime. With a diverse range of tools available—from mobile-first platforms to AI-powered solutions—selecting the right software is critical to meeting operational needs.

Standout Feature

Conversational work orders that transform traditional tickets into interactive chat threads for faster resolutions and team communication

MaintainX is a mobile-first CMMS platform that excels in work order processing, preventive maintenance, and asset management for maintenance teams. It allows users to create, assign, track, and complete work orders in real-time via an intuitive app, with features like photo uploads, checklists, and threaded conversations for collaboration. The software also supports inventory tracking, custom audits, and integrations with tools like Slack and QuickBooks, making it ideal for streamlining field operations.

Pros

  • Exceptionally intuitive mobile interface that speeds up work order completion
  • Robust preventive maintenance scheduling with automated reminders and compliance tracking
  • Real-time collaboration via conversational threads and instant updates across teams

Cons

  • Advanced reporting and analytics limited to higher-tier plans
  • Inventory management lacks depth for very large-scale operations
  • Some enterprise-level custom integrations require developer support

Best For

Small to mid-sized maintenance teams in manufacturing, facilities, or hospitality seeking a simple, mobile-centric work order solution.

Pricing

Free plan for basic use; Pro at $16/user/month, Business at $39/user/month (billed annually).

Standout Feature

Mobile-first design with QR code asset scanning and real-time work order updates for field technicians

UpKeep is a mobile-first CMMS platform specializing in work order management, asset tracking, and preventive maintenance for maintenance teams. It enables quick creation, assignment, and real-time tracking of work orders via an intuitive mobile app, reducing downtime and improving response times. The software also includes inventory management, customizable dashboards, and reporting to streamline operations across facilities, manufacturing, and hospitality.

Pros

  • Highly intuitive mobile app for on-the-go work order processing
  • Real-time updates, notifications, and collaborative tools
  • Seamless integrations with QuickBooks, Slack, and other tools

Cons

  • Reporting and analytics limited in lower-tier plans
  • Pricing scales per technician, which can get expensive for large teams
  • Customization options are somewhat restricted compared to enterprise competitors

Best For

Small to mid-sized maintenance teams in facilities or manufacturing needing a simple, mobile-centric solution for efficient work order dispatch and tracking.

Pricing

Free for single users; paid plans start at $45/technician/month (billed annually) for Starter, $65 for Essentials, $90 for Professional, and custom Enterprise pricing.

Standout Feature

Lightning-fast implementation, getting teams up and running in minutes with minimal training required.

Limble CMMS is a cloud-based computerized maintenance management system (CMMS) focused on simplifying work order creation, assignment, tracking, and completion for maintenance teams. It offers robust tools for preventive maintenance scheduling, asset tracking, inventory management, and mobile accessibility to ensure real-time updates and reduced downtime. With an emphasis on user-friendliness, it enables quick deployment and efficient workflow automation tailored for work order processing in various industries.

Pros

  • Intuitive interface with mobile app for on-the-go work order management
  • Unlimited users included in all plans for excellent scalability
  • Rapid setup and onboarding in under 30 minutes

Cons

  • Reporting capabilities are solid but lack advanced customization
  • Fewer native integrations compared to enterprise-level competitors
  • Pricing model scales with locations rather than users, which may add up for multi-site operations

Best For

Small to medium-sized businesses in facilities management, manufacturing, or hospitality needing a straightforward, easy-to-implement work order processing solution.

Pricing

Starts at $60/month for Starter plan (unlimited users, 1 location), up to $240/month for Premium; location-based scaling and free trial available.

Standout Feature

Real-time mobile work order execution with photo attachments and GPS tracking for field efficiency

Fiix is a cloud-based CMMS software that excels in work order processing by enabling quick creation, assignment, scheduling, and tracking of maintenance tasks. It integrates asset management, preventive maintenance, inventory control, and reporting tools to streamline operations and minimize downtime. Users benefit from mobile accessibility and real-time updates, making it ideal for field technicians and maintenance teams. Overall, it supports data-driven decisions through customizable dashboards and analytics.

Pros

  • Highly intuitive mobile app for real-time work order updates
  • Strong preventive maintenance scheduling and automation
  • Excellent reporting and analytics for performance insights

Cons

  • Limited advanced customization options compared to enterprise rivals
  • Pricing increases significantly for larger teams or add-ons
  • Inventory management can feel basic for complex operations

Best For

Mid-sized maintenance teams in manufacturing, facilities, or fleet management seeking an user-friendly CMMS for efficient work order handling.

Pricing

Starts at $46/user/month (billed annually) for Starter plan; Professional ($96/user/month) and Enterprise (custom) offer more features.

Standout Feature

Drag-and-drop Kanban boards for real-time visual tracking and prioritization of work orders

Hippo CMMS is a cloud-based computerized maintenance management system (CMMS) focused on efficient work order processing, asset tracking, and preventive maintenance for facilities teams. It enables users to create, assign, prioritize, and track work orders through an intuitive web and mobile interface, complete with photo attachments and real-time updates. Additional features include inventory management, customizable reporting, and Kanban-style boards for visual workflow management, helping reduce downtime and improve operational efficiency.

Pros

  • Highly intuitive interface with quick setup and minimal training needed
  • Strong mobile app for on-the-go work order access and updates
  • Affordable pricing with no long-term contracts

Cons

  • Reporting and analytics lack depth for complex needs
  • Limited native integrations with enterprise systems
  • Customization options are somewhat basic

Best For

Small to medium-sized facilities maintenance teams needing a straightforward, cost-effective tool for daily work order management.

Pricing

Starts at $197/month for up to 5 users (Basic), $397/month for Standard (unlimited users), with custom Enterprise quotes.

Standout Feature

Drag-and-drop workflow builder for unlimited no-code customizations

eMaint is a robust CMMS platform specializing in work order processing, allowing users to create, assign, track, and complete maintenance tasks efficiently across assets and locations. It supports preventive maintenance scheduling, inventory management, and mobile access for real-time updates from the field. The software provides customizable workflows and advanced reporting to help organizations minimize downtime and optimize maintenance operations.

Pros

  • Highly customizable workflows and fields without coding
  • Excellent mobile app for field technicians
  • Comprehensive reporting and analytics tools

Cons

  • Steeper learning curve for complex configurations
  • Pricing lacks transparency and can be costly for small teams
  • On-premise setup requires more IT resources

Best For

Mid-sized manufacturing or facilities management teams needing flexible, scalable work order management.

Pricing

Custom quote-based pricing; cloud plans typically start around $60/user/month with annual contracts.

Standout Feature

Visual kanban-style work order boards for drag-and-drop prioritization and assignment

Maintenance Care is a cloud-based CMMS platform specializing in work order management, preventive maintenance, and asset tracking for facilities maintenance teams. It enables users to create, assign, prioritize, and track work orders via an intuitive dashboard and robust mobile app, with real-time notifications and updates. The software also includes reporting analytics, inventory control, and customizable forms to streamline operations and reduce downtime.

Pros

  • User-friendly interface with quick setup
  • Powerful mobile app for field technicians
  • Strong reporting and analytics tools

Cons

  • Limited advanced customization options
  • Integrations with third-party tools are basic
  • Pricing can be steep for very small teams

Best For

Small to mid-sized facilities maintenance teams seeking an intuitive, mobile-first work order solution without complex setup.

Pricing

Starts at $59/user/month (billed annually) for Basic plan; Pro at $79/user/month; Enterprise custom.

Standout Feature

AI-powered predictive analytics that proactively generates and prioritizes work orders based on real-time asset data from IoT sensors

Fracttal One is a cloud-based CMMS platform specializing in asset management and maintenance operations, with strong work order processing features for creating, assigning, scheduling, and tracking tasks in real-time. It supports mobile access for technicians, enabling on-the-go updates, approvals, and attachments like photos or notes. The software integrates IoT sensors and AI analytics to predict failures and automate work order generation, streamlining preventive maintenance workflows.

Pros

  • Intuitive mobile app for field technicians to handle work orders efficiently
  • AI and IoT integration for predictive work order automation
  • Comprehensive reporting and analytics for work order performance

Cons

  • Pricing can be opaque and higher for smaller teams
  • Limited native integrations with non-Latin American ERPs
  • Advanced AI features require additional setup and sensors

Best For

Medium to large industrial or manufacturing teams needing predictive maintenance tied to work order processing.

Pricing

Subscription-based starting at ~$20-30/user/month for basic plans; scales to enterprise custom pricing with modules for IoT/AI.

Standout Feature

Client Hub for self-service quote approvals, work order updates, and payments

Jobber is a cloud-based field service management software tailored for small to medium-sized home service businesses, enabling efficient creation, assignment, and tracking of work orders. It integrates scheduling, dispatching, invoicing, and customer communication into a single platform, allowing teams to convert quotes into work orders and invoices seamlessly. Real-time GPS tracking and mobile access ensure field workers can update job status on the go, while the client hub empowers customers to approve work and make payments independently.

Pros

  • Intuitive drag-and-drop scheduling and real-time dispatching for work orders
  • Seamless invoicing and payment processing directly from work orders
  • Robust mobile app for field updates and GPS tracking

Cons

  • Pricing increases significantly with more users and advanced features
  • Limited reporting and analytics in entry-level plans
  • Fewer advanced customization options compared to enterprise competitors

Best For

Small to medium field service businesses like plumbers, electricians, and landscapers needing straightforward work order processing without complex setups.

Pricing

Starts at $49/month (Lite, 1 user, billed annually), Core at $169 (up to 7 users), Connect at $349 (up to 30 users), Grow custom pricing; monthly billing available at higher rates.

Standout Feature

Real-time dispatching with GPS tracking and intelligent routing that optimizes technician assignments directly from work orders

ServiceTitan is a comprehensive field service management platform designed for home service businesses like HVAC, plumbing, and electrical contractors, with robust work order processing at its core. It allows for quick creation, dispatching, and real-time tracking of work orders via a centralized dashboard and mobile app for technicians. Key functionalities include automated scheduling, job status updates, on-site invoicing, and payment collection, all integrated with CRM and accounting tools for end-to-end efficiency.

Pros

  • Advanced automation for work order creation, assignment, and completion
  • Powerful mobile app enabling real-time updates, photo capture, and payments
  • Deep integrations with QuickBooks, payment processors, and marketing tools

Cons

  • Steep learning curve and complex initial setup
  • High cost makes it less accessible for small businesses
  • Overwhelming feature set for users needing simple work order tools

Best For

Mid-sized to large home service companies with high-volume work orders requiring enterprise-level automation and scalability.

Pricing

Custom quote-based pricing; typically starts at $200-500 per user/month plus implementation fees, scaling with business size.
